2026 Wake County Elementary Honors Chorus

 

 


 

On Friday, February 20th and Saturday, February 21st, 2026 a delegation of four students from Barton Pond attended the annual Wake County Public Schools Elementary Honors Chorus event! The students performed the following songs with their 4th and 5th grade peers from around Wake County: "Sing to Me" by Andrea Ramsey, "Quia fecit mihi magna" arranged by Tom Shelton, "Be Who You Are" by Ryan Main, "We Will Sing the World Whole" by Mark Burrows, "Get on Board" arranged by Paul Caldwell and Sean Ivory, and "Animal Imagination" by Tom Shelton. The clinician for the event was Tom Shelton, who did a phenomenal job of preparing students for the final performance. The students did an amazing job at this concert and we are looking forward to sending another delegation of students to this event next year!

NC Symphony 2026

 


On Tuesday, January 6th, 2026 the 4th graders at Barton Pond attended the annual North Carolina Symphony field trip! Students heard works by Beethoven, Anthony Kelley, Jesse Montgomery, Bizet, Grieg, Schubert, Verdi, John Stafford Smith, and Francis Scott Key. Students also heard special performances by each section of the NC Symphony that highlighted sounds and timbres produced by each instrument family. The students had a great time on this field trip and our rising 4th graders look forward to going on this field trip next year!

2025 NC Elementary Honors Chorus






On Sunday, November 9th, 2025, Layna Holland made history as the first student at Barton Pond Elementary to perform with the North Carolina Elementary Honors Chorus! Members of the 2025 NC Elementary Honors Chorus had the opportunity to work with Joshua Pedde, the executive artistic director of the Indianapolis Children's Choir, who was the clinician for the event. The students  performed the following songs at the concert: "Laudamus Te" by Antonio Vivaldi, "Shenandoah" arranged by Rollo Dilworth, "The Star" by Harry Richardson, "Now is the Time" by Leeann Starkey, "Hi! Ho! The Rattlin' Bog" arranged by Ken Berg, and "Sesere Eeye" arranged by Matthew Doyle. Layna had a great time representing our school at this event and we look forward to sending more students to be a part of this chorus in the future!

2025 Raleigh Youth Choir Explosion

On Friday, September 26th and Saturday, September 27th students from Barton Pond participated in the 2025 Raleigh Youth Choir Explosion at First Presbyterian Church in Raleigh, North Carolina! The delegation had the opportunity to sing with members of the Raleigh Youth Choir and their 4th and 5th grade peers from around Wake County. The students performed "One Candle", "Making a Paper Airplane", and "Raining Tacos" written and arranged by Andy Beck and "Ac-Cent-Tchu-Ate the Positive" arranged by Steve Zegree". They had the opportunity to attend choral clinics with the following conductors of the Raleigh Youth Choir: Amy Davis, Bo Reece, Casey Eaton, and Aaron Brown. All-County Chorus 2025

On February 7th & 8th, 2025, a delegation of students from Barton Pond attended the 2025 Elementary Honors Chorus event for the Wake County Public School System. The students were able to sing with other 4th and 5th grade students from around Wake County and work with Dr. Lauren Saeger, a distinguished choral clinician. Students performed "Never Give Up" by Rollo Dillworth, "Dum Spiro Spero" by Kara Stacy Bedwell, "Onomatopoeia" by Mark Burrows, "How Doth the Little Crocodile" by Mark Burrows, and "Here Comes the Sun" arranged by Matt and Adam Podd.
